A. AHBR 20-308 5684 Reserve Lane (Informal Discussion)
New Residential Construction (One-Story, Single Family Home)
Submitted by Angela Ryan, Memmer Homes
a) The Land Development Code requires the setback to be within ten (10)
percent of the adjacent properties. Staff notes proposed house would be
set back behind the adjacent property at 5700 Reserve Lane, though the
property in question is a 6.22 acre lot and substantially screened.
b) Staff notes the Architectural Design Standards classify the home as a
Large Mass Type.
c) Question if garage/master bedroom mass should be broken up. Staff
notes a continuous ridge of approximately eighty (80) feet.
d) Architectural Design Standards state there should be a single dominant
material used for all the walls of the building. A second material may be
used to accent certain features, such as building projection gable ends,
entrance recesses or to emphasize horizontal or vertical division of the
building. Staff notes vertical siding, stone, and horizontal siding are
proposed as wall materials.
e) Architectural Design Standards state porches may not extend outward
from the most forward mass of the building.
f) Revise front step to be full width of door openings.
